> 3) I don't want to use my Opal and ptlib system libraries,I want to put
>    specific Opal/ptlib in my home directory but I did ./configure --help
>    and I did not see any option to configure(type --with-opal-dir=/...
>    --with-ptlib-dir=/... to customise this).Can the configure script
>    scan my directories to detect them or only if they are installed
>    under /usr/local;/usr/lib etc.?
